Wow! The Galaxy rasboras looking amazing! How do u guys find their schooling behavior to be like? I like the really tight schools like how the rummy nose do but I also want them to be colorful and vibrant. Ive done cardinal tetras but they just dont seem to be very hardy fish.
Galaxy rasboras look fantastic once they have coloured up. I find that when fish are really comfortable in their tank that they tend to school much less. The only time I've seen really tight schooling is when I've had fish like cardinals in a tank with bigger fish.
